Vapor-Liquid Equilibrium Data Set 5046

Components

No. Formula Molar Mass CAS Registry Number Name
1 C6H6 78.114 71-43-2 Benzene
2 C16H34 226.446 544-76-3 Hexadecane

Constant Value

Temperature 313.15 K

Data Table

P [kPa] x1 [mol/mol]
8.599 0.34900
10.919 0.44300
12.532 0.50900
14.465 0.58000
15.919 0.63500
17.759 0.71400
18.798 0.76500
20.118 0.81800
20.798 0.85000
22.491 0.91700
23.251 0.95700
24.078 0.99400
24.331 1.00000

(P - pressure, x - liquid mole fraction)

Reference

Source
Messow U.; Schütze D.; Hauthal W.H.: II. Benzol(1)/n-Tetradecan(2), Benzol(1)/n-Hexadecan(2) und Benzol(1)/n-Heptadecan(2). Z.Phys.Chem.(Leipzig) 257 (1976) 218-228


Vapor-Liquid Equilibrium Data Set 5047

Components

No. Formula Molar Mass CAS Registry Number Name
1 C6H6 78.114 71-43-2 Benzene
2 C16H34 226.446 544-76-3 Hexadecane

Constant Value

Temperature 333.15 K

Data Table

P [kPa] x1 [mol/mol]
0.00266644730882 0.00000
7.719 0.15600
9.226 0.18600
12.972 0.26000
18.119 0.35900
22.758 0.44300
26.305 0.50900
30.198 0.58000
33.424 0.63500
37.317 0.71400
39.903 0.76500
42.676 0.81800
44.410 0.85000
48.023 0.91700
49.889 0.95700
51.676 0.99400
52.022 1.00000

(P - pressure, x - liquid mole fraction)

Reference

Source
Messow U.; Schütze D.; Hauthal W.H.: II. Benzol(1)/n-Tetradecan(2), Benzol(1)/n-Hexadecan(2) und Benzol(1)/n-Heptadecan(2). Z.Phys.Chem.(Leipzig) 257 (1976) 218-228


Vapor-Liquid Equilibrium Data Set 5048

Components

No. Formula Molar Mass CAS Registry Number Name
1 C6H6 78.114 71-43-2 Benzene
2 C16H34 226.446 544-76-3 Hexadecane

Constant Value

Temperature 353.15 K

Data Table

P [kPa] x1 [mol/mol]
0.014665 0.00000
11.199 0.12300
15.919 0.17600
21.198 0.23300
22.478 0.24600
33.304 0.35900
41.943 0.44300
49.116 0.50900
56.889 0.58000
63.021 0.63500
71.061 0.71400
76.727 0.76500
81.993 0.81800
85.420 0.85000
92.859 0.91700
96.619 0.95700
100.552 1.00000

(P - pressure, x - liquid mole fraction)

Reference

Source
Messow U.; Schütze D.; Hauthal W.H.: II. Benzol(1)/n-Tetradecan(2), Benzol(1)/n-Hexadecan(2) und Benzol(1)/n-Heptadecan(2). Z.Phys.Chem.(Leipzig) 257 (1976) 218-228
